MAS Marked2 Crashes on start
I wanted to use a custom multimarkdown processor the mac appstore version and followed the directions here:
http://support.markedapp.com/kb/frequently-asked-questions/custom-p...
Marked2 crashed and now crashes on startup. I suspect it doesn't like /bin/bash and this is saved somewhere in a .plist I can't find. I'd like to just delete this saved preference and try again but I can't seem to find where it is. Otherwise I'll use AppCleaner to uninstall it and reinstall from MAS but I'd rather not loose my other prefs. (I can edit a preference file if I can find it to try just removing the /bin/bash).
macOS 10.14.6, 3.4 GHz Late 2012 i7 iMac

Glad to hear it. For the record, there _shouldn't_ be a problem using
/bin/bash as the executable, but the sandboxing errors change now and
then. If you'd like to switch to the direct version and avoid sandboxing
issues all together, just let me know.
